Top 5 Bold Styles for Short Curly Hair Men

1. Textured Crop with Undercut

If there’s a quintessential hairstyle for short curly hair men, it’s the textured crop paired with an undercut. This look balances a head of voluminous curls on top with a sleek undercut, creating a drama that captivates. Brands like American Crew have crafted styling products that accentuate curls and maintain a sharp appearance. Celebrities like Timothée Chalamet rock this style, proving it’s versatile enough for both casual hangouts and red carpet galas.
